Social workers aid people and groups identify, address, and cope with personal and social issues they deal with every day. Whether working with an individual handling breast cancer or someone in an unpredictable relationship, social employees lean on various clinical abilities to help individuals address conditions or situations in a healthy, efficient way.
Bachelor's degree in social work, master's in social work Differs by state, however state licensure is needed Psychiatric social workers use the very same foundational training as other social employees, however they also hang around gaining medical expertise in centers that use psychiatric services. These social employees assist their clients handle psychological health conditions and access the assistance and resources they need.
Psychiatric social workers typically have training in group treatment and crisis interventions. Associate degree in nursing RN licensure, Forensic nursing certification, Sexual assault nurse inspector certification Domestic violence nurses usually hold both RN licensure and complete certification requirements in forensic nursing and sexual attack nursing. In addition to providing psychological, mental health, and physical assistance for clients, these professionals likewise act as supporters for domestic violence survivors in legal matters.
In addition to scientific settings, these professionals often work closely with police. High school diploma Domestic violence advocates work carefully with survivors of domestic violence. Typically along with federal government organizations and nonprofits, these workers help survivors in finding safe housing, medical services, and legal resources. A few of these specialists also utilize training to conduct counseling and assistance groups.
Common careers for individuals in public health and females's advocacy consist of ladies's health teachers and women's health researchers. These specialists lean on academic and professional training to expand neighborhood wellness while advocating for their customers. Continue reading to get more information about these important careers. Often working in community settings, ladies's health teachers offer instructional programs to promote both specific and neighborhood wellness.
They facilitate communications between customers and healthcare and social service companies. Women's health teachers work in healthcare centers, public health departments, neighborhood companies, and different nonprofits. Typical obligations consist of examining clients' health requirements, assisting clients safe various health services, lobbying for broadened health resources, and establishing brand-new programs through a data-centric method.
In addition to event and examining information, these experts likewise craft and report findings to various federal government, health, neighborhood, and health education groups. Women's health research can operate in a range of settings, including healthcare facilities, public health departments, and nonprofits. Due to the data-based method to ladies's health, these workers frequently have scholastic backgrounds in the social sciences.
Nonprofit program managers play a vital function in the day-to-day functioning of not-for-profit organizations. These specialists work with management and personnel and oversee important components like budgets, staffing, and planning. Nonprofit managers likewise contribute as project managers, ensuring desired results and examining the effectiveness and effect of numerous tasks.
Larger nonprofits may aim to managers with extensive experience, strong management abilities, and graduate-level degrees in locations consisting of organization and management. Due to the fact that females's health is such a broad expert location, the primary step in landing a task after college is identifying which area of ladies's health is a good fit.
Additionally, more targeted certificate programs can help college grads even more refine their skills while expanding career choices and earning prospective. Throughout college and beyond, networking with ladies's health organizations and experts is a time-tested way to jumpstart a career in ladies's health. Whether a student completes an internship or devotes time volunteering at a women's health organization, these experiences frequently lay a professional structure on which college graduates can build.
Women's health is special due to the fact that it includes an expansive spectrum of professions and disciplines. Medical physicians, social workers, and service specialists all gain abilities that can be relevant in women's health. Some popular degrees for those pursuing a career in females's health consist of clinical functions like nursing and radiology and also any number of social science and organization programs.
